What Did Aptech Ltd Report This Quarter?

Headline numbers from the latest earnings call

Revenue

₹137.11 Cr

YoY +24.41%QoQ +1.65%

Revenue reached an all-time high driven by improved student enrollment trends across learning centers and training programs.

EBITDA

₹13.63 Cr

YoY +107.36%Margin 9.94%

Margins expanded significantly due to better cost management and operating leverage, though historical volatility remains a concern.

PAT

₹8.56 Cr

YoY +139.11%QoQ +32.51%

Profit growth was aided by a normalized tax rate of 29.20% compared to an abnormally high 58.28% in the previous year's quarter.

Other Highlights

• Exceptional charge of ₹2.40 Cr due to New Labour Code implementation.

• Company maintained debt-free status with a net cash position.

• Institutional segment revenue grew significantly to ₹35.32 Cr from ₹6.55 Cr YoY.

What Sector Metrics Matter for Aptech Ltd?

Sub-sector-specific signals from the latest concall — each with management's stated reason for the change

Retail Segment Revenue

₹101.79 Cr

YoY -1.8%QoQ Not Given

Why: Marginal decline in the core retail training business despite overall company growth.

Institutional Segment Revenue

₹35.32 Cr

YoY +439.2%QoQ Not Given

Why: Significant growth in enterprise and government training solutions.

Operating Margin (Excl. Other Income)

9.94%

YoY +410 bpsQoQ Not Given

Why: Improved operational efficiency and cost management reaching a quarterly high.

Return on Equity (ROE)

9.16%

YoY DeclinedQoQ Not Given

Why: ROE has declined below the five-year average of 18.17%, indicating challenges in capital efficiency.

Debtors Turnover Ratio

10.26x

YoY ImprovedQoQ Not Given

Why: Effectiveness in settling debtors more swiftly, reaching a multi-period high.

Effective Tax Rate

29.20%

YoY -2908 bpsQoQ Not Given

Why: Normalization from an abnormally high tax rate of 58.28% in Q3 FY25.
